option
Questions
ayuda
daypo
search.php

Jaba 3

COMMENTS STATISTICS RECORDS
TAKE THE TEST
Title of test:
Jaba 3

Description:
Jaba 3 slov slov slov

Creation Date: 2026/06/15

Category: Others

Number of questions: 21

Rating:(0)
Share the Test:
Nuevo ComentarioNuevo Comentario
New Comment
NO RECORDS
Content:

Vyberte pravdivá tvrzení o datovém typu pointer: Proměnná typu pointer může odkazovat na hodnotu, které již byla zrušena. Po nevhodné aritmetice s proměnnou typu pointer může proměnná ukazovat jinam, než kam bylo zamýšleno. Typ pointer podporuje operace přiřazení adresy, přičítání celého čísla k adrese a odečítání celého čísla od adresy. Java podporuje datový typ pointer.

Vyberte pravdivá tvrzení o objektech a abstraktních datových typech. Třídy v objektových programovacích jazycích jsou příklady abstraktního datového typu. Abstraktní datový typ (ADT) umožňuje ukrývat implementaci. V programu lze deklarovat a inicializovat proměnné abstraktního datového typu. Při deklaraci abstraktního datového typu (ADT) může programátor definovat operace(metody, funkce) pro tento typ. Při deklaraci abstraktního datového typu lze použít dědičnost a to i v případě, že se nejedná o třídu v OOP jazycích.

Vyberte pravdivá tvrzení o jednotkovém testování pomocí Junit. Dle konvencí by jméno testovací třídy mělo tvořit jméno testové třídy a slovo Test. Pro porovnání očekávané hodnoty se skutečnou návratovou hodnotou se v testech nejčastěji používá metoda assertEquals. S pomocí Junit se většinou testuje veřejné rozhraní (API) třídy. Dle konvencí by jméno testovací metody mělo začínat slovem test. Pomocí Junit testů lze přímo otestovat privátní metody testované třídy. Pomocí JUnit testů nelze testovat vznik výjimek v testované metodě.

Vyberte pravdivá tvrzení o vedlejších efektech metody (výrazu): Vedlejší efekt metody (výrazu) označuje situaci, kdy metoda (či výraz) mění i jinýstav (proměnnou) procesu, než je návratová hodnota. Metody bez vedlejších efektů jsou čitelnější, neboť při pochopení významu senemusí brát v úvahu další proměnné mimo metodu. Operátor ++ v Javě je příkladem operátoru s vedlejším efektem - vrací návratovou hodnotu a současně zvyšuje hodnotu příslušné proměnné. Metody bez vedlejších efektů deklarované uvnitř třídy nemění hodnotu datových atributů instance této třídy. Pokud by metody met1 a met2 v následující ukázce byly bez vedlejších efektů, tak nezávisí na pořadí volání následujících dvou příkazů: int a = met1(prom1);int b =met2(prom2);.

Vyberte pravdivé výroky o jazyce Prolog: Databáze v pojetí Prologu je seznam fakt a pravidel. Fakta v Prologu popisují vlastnosti objektů a vztahy mezi objekty. Pravidla umožňují ze stávajících fakt odvozovat další fakta. Prolog podporuje cykly i v rekurzi. V Prologu jsou všechny proměnné stejného typu.

Vyberte správnou verzi hlavičky metody, která se musí ve třídě nadeklarovat pro spuštění. Public static void main (String [ ] cokoliv). Java aplikace z příkazové řádky:. Static void main (String [ ] ars). Public static void start (String [ ] arametry). Public static void main (String args).

Výjimky dělíme na: kontrolované x nekontrolované. nepoužíváme žádné z uvedených dělení. aplikační x programové x systémové. ošetřené x neošetřené.

Z konstruktoru lze volat. jiný konstruktor téže třídy. konstruktor potomka. konstruktor předka. statickou metodu téže třídy.

Z následujícího seznamu vyberte funkcionální programovací jazyky: C. LISP. Pearl. Haskel. Scheme. Common Lisp. Java. Ruby. ML.

Z následujícího seznamu vyberte programovací jazyky, které byly od začátku navrženy s objekty: Cobol. C#. LISP. Prolog. Java. Python. Smalltalk.

Záhlaví konstruktoru může obsahovat: modifikátor protected. klauzuli implements. modifikátor final. klauzuli throws. deklaraci formálních parametrů metody. modifikátor private.

Záhlaví metody může obsahovat: modifikátor protected. klauzuli implements. návratovou hodnotu. klauzuli throws.

Záhlaví třídy (samostatně ne vnitřním nebo vnořené) může obsahovat: Klauzuli implements. Klauzuli throw. Modifikátor Protected. Návratovou hodnotu.

Přiřaďte dokumentační značky pro javadoc k metodám: @version. @return. @param. @author. @exception.

Přiřaďte dokumentační značky pro javadoc k třídám: @version. @return. @param. @author. @exception.

Přiřaďte Java jmenné konvence k jednotlivým identifikátorům. konvence: mNV = malé Názvy Velbloudí (camelCase). lokální proměnné. statické konstanty. metody. statické proměnné. třídy. výčtového typu enum. rozhraní.

Přiřaďte Java jmenné konvence k jednotlivým identifikátorům. konvence: VNV = Velké Názvy Velbloudí (PascalCase). lokální proměnné. statické konstanty. metody. statické proměnné. třídy. výčtového typu enum. rozhraní.

Přiřaďte Java jmenné konvence k jednotlivým identifikátorům. konvence: všechna velká = (SCREAMING_SNAKE_CASE). lokální proměnné. statické konstanty. metody. statické proměnné. třídy. výčtového typu enum. rozhraní.

Přiřaďte jednotlivé činnosti k: lexikální analýze. Odstranění komentářů ze zdrojového kódu probíhá při. Identifikace klíčových slov (např. if či for v Javě) probíhá při. Syntaktický strom se vytváří při. Generování mezikódu je součástí. Kontrola správného zápisu příkazu při.

Přiřaďte jednotlivé činnosti k: syntaktické analýze. Odstranění komentářů ze zdrojového kódu probíhá při. Identifikace klíčových slov (např. if či for v Javě) probíhá při. Syntaktický strom se vytváří při. Generování mezikódu je součástí. Kontrola správného zápisu příkazu při.

Přiřaďte jednotlivé činnosti k: sémantické analýze. Odstranění komentářů ze zdrojového kódu probíhá při. Identifikace klíčových slov (např. if či for v Javě) probíhá při. Syntaktický strom se vytváří při. Generování mezikódu je součástí. Kontrola správného zápisu příkazu při.

Report abuse